Detailed Engineering Specifications

Precision-manufactured to tight tolerances, this Titanium Grade 5 stock sheet (0.299" x 27" x 18") leverages the alloy's characteristic high tensile strength (128 ksi minimum), excellent fatigue strength, and superior corrosion resistance in aggressive environments. Its biocompatibility and low modulus of elasticity make it suitable for specialized protective packaging and structural components in aerospace and marine shipping. The material's excellent formability allows for custom configurations without compromising structural integrity.

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id Them

❌ Mistake✅ Correct Approach
Using standard cutting tools not rated for titanium alloys, leading to tool wear and poor cut quality.Employ carbide or high-speed steel cutting tools specifically designed for titanium machining, utilizing appropriate speeds and feeds.
Inadequate support during forming operations, causing localized stress and potential cracking.Utilize well-supported tooling and sufficient clearance during bending or stamping to prevent overstressing the material.

⚠️ Engineering Warnings

  • Titanium Grade 5 can be pyrophoric when finely divided; exercise caution with dust and shavings.
  • Ensure proper ventilation when welding or machining Titanium Grade 5 to avoid inhalation of metal fumes.
